3/3 Zack Schroeder Participates at Nationals.
Concordia junior wrestler Zack Schroeder (Wahpeton, ND) participated at the NCAA Division III National Wrestling Meet. Schroeder received a bye in the first round in the 133 pound weight class before losing his second round match to Dan Flounders of the College of New Jersey 8-0. Flounders advanced to the championship match in the weight class. Schroeder dropped a close 7-4 decision in the quarterfinals of the consolation round to Dorian Cast of Olivet College. Schroeder is the first Cobbers to compete at the national meet since All-American Nathan Reiff placed seventh in 1999. 2/24 Concordia's Young Squad

1/27 Concordia Wins Out on Saturday, Finishes Third at MIAC Duals.
Concordia won all three matches on Saturday to move their overall record in the MIAC Dual Meet to 3-2, and finish in third place. The Cobbers defeated St. Thomas 45-12, St. Olaf 35-18 and Carleton 47-9. This came after a hard fought Friday, when they dropped matches to perennial national champion, and MIAC Dual Meet winner, Augsburg and St. John's. The Cobbers were led by Zack Schroeder (Jr., Wahpeton, ND) who went 4-1 on the weekend at 133 pounds, and Rory Olson (Jr., Wadena, MN), at 174, who was also 4-1 and recorded three victories by pin. First year wrestler Pete Grossarth (Thompson Falls, MT) went 3-2 at 125, and Jared Sannes (Jr.,Crookston, MN) went 3-2 at 197, all three wins by pin. The third place finish at the MIAC Dual Meet is the highest finish since the 1995-96 season when they finished third. Concordia started fast, winning the first match of the meet at 149, but then MSU-Moorhead took control and battled to a 31-6 victory. Cory Winter (Fr., Cannon Falls, MN) gave the Cobbers a 3-0 lead early, as he won by decision over Adam Toso 4-1. The Dragons then proceeded to win eight of the next nine matches and pull away for the win. The lone victory for Concordia in that stretch was put up by JakeWiese (So., Pelican Rapids, MN) at 184. Wiese decisioned Dave Roberts 10-8 in a tightly contested match. Wiese went on top early and then hung on for the two point margin of victory. The other highlight of the meet was the battle at 133 where MSU-Moorhead's Shawn Larson edged out Zack Schroeder (Wahpeton, ND). Both wrestlers traded leads, and Larson was able to wear Schroeder down in the late stages of the match to come away with the decision. 12/05 Game Day Preview: Concordia vs. MSU-Moorhead. 12/02 Complete Results From

Concordia, with 13 wrestlers competing in the tournament, was led by Jesse Barnacle (Fr., Deer River, MN) who lost in the title match in the 157 division to Lance Wurm from NDSU. Concordia junior Zack Schroeder (Wahpeton, ND), battling an injury, advanced to the semifinals at 133 before losing in a physical match to Reese Boehm of NDSU. Schroeder fought through pain and eventually finished fourth. Cory Winter (Fr., Cannon Falls, MN) lost 5-3 in a tight fought quarterfinal match at 149 to eventual division champion Bo Henry of NDSU.
